Output efa1ab3ec41536219655f220cf0dc217e5fdf4e9cecd5d5ea28af9fb543c2ed2:0

value
1044084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17de486cb4a0818de51a64e5716199f2b9905ba0 OP_EQUAL
address
33sDkSeswcZ55dbz2WGUFc3KxZnY1ZF63c
transaction
efa1ab3ec41536219655f220cf0dc217e5fdf4e9cecd5d5ea28af9fb543c2ed2
spent
true